Transaction f768bda3fe2ed17d4073db80fd7f7ccfd68cd7cdebcab6a3988f075e6b446747
1 Input
1 Output
-
f768bda3fe2ed17d4073db80fd7f7ccfd68cd7cdebcab6a3988f075e6b446747:0
- value
- 21054024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 361b6954282acb1d67801cb4e8ac41997c729b72 OP_EQUAL
- address
- MCqFZNNa8CeL4yh64QvWrh754i9ee9nAq6